  I got the PR approval letter asking me to send Right of Permanent Residence Fee(RPRF) and our Passports for Stamping. I have a one yar old son who is born in USA and he has a passport also.
The question is, should I send the RPRF for my Son too ? or only me and my wife ?
it is $445 per person.
On the letter it says,
" Every principal applicant and his/her accompanying spouse/common law parter is required to pay a RPRF in the amount of $445 USD"

am I understading this correctly ?
Any ideas ? Please
and one more, I am intended to take my son along with us when we are going to land in Canada from USA, does this make any difference ?

According to the rules published by CIC for PR (at least for the one through Skilled Worker) it says clearly that RPRF are exempt for dependent children.

You stated " Every principal applicant and his/her accompanying spouse/common law parter is required to pay a RPRF in the amount of $445 USD"

It does not say "and dependent children" so I am quite sure your son is exempt.

You can check the CIC website just to make sure.
